The Origin Story: Roots in Chicano Culture
The upside down LA Dodgers logo hat, or the “low-rider logo” as some people call it, has deep roots in Chicano culture. Back in the day, especially in the Latino communities of Los Angeles, it was a way of expressing a sense of identity and pride. It wasn't just about baseball; it was a way of reclaiming the Dodgers and making them their own. The team, being in LA, naturally resonated with the large Hispanic population of the city. So, the simple act of flipping the logo became a powerful symbol of community and solidarity. It was a way of saying, "Hey, we're here, we're fans, and we're doing things our way.” Pretty cool, right?
This trend started gaining traction in the late 20th century. During a time of significant social and cultural shifts, the upside-down logo became a subtle yet potent form of self-expression. It wasn't just a style; it was a statement. The upside down LA Dodgers logo hat meaning transformed into a representation of cultural pride and a symbol of resistance. This simple modification was enough to distinguish the wearers, creating a visual marker of belonging and a means of uniting with others. This also coincided with a growing interest in lowrider culture, which also featured a sense of customisation and rebellion, and as a result, this style blended seamlessly into the culture.
